Preheat oven to 350u00b0. In a large bowl, stir together flour, sugar, butter, eggs, almond extract, and salt. Spray two 9-in. pie pans with cooking oil. Divide batter evenly between pans and sprinkle each with half of the almonds. Bake until light brown around edges, about 30 minutes. Serve warm or at room temperature.

The Twist: Layer Them. To quickly transform these modest cakes into showpieces, use a serrated knife to carefully slice each cake horizontally into 2 even layers. Whip 4 cups heavy cream with 1 cup sugar until stiff peaks form. Spread each bottom layer with 1 cup of the whipped cream and sprinkle with fresh raspberries. Add top layers and spread with remaining whipped cream; top with more raspberries. (If you only want to layer 1 of the cakes, just halve the amounts here.)
